• László Németh's avatar
    tdf#115007 NatNum12 "spell out" formats in dates · 958c2324
    László Németh yazdı
    to support variants of preposition, suffixation,
    article or their combination. For example, Catalan
    "de març"/"d'abril", English "1st of May"/"First of
    May" or Hungarian "május 1-je/május 2-a".
    
    When the date format contains more than a date keyword,
    it needs to specify in NatNum12 argument which date
    element needs special formatting by using libnumbertext:
    
    '[NatNum12 ordinal-number]D'              -> "1st"
    '[NatNum12 D=ordinal-number]D" of "MMMM'  -> "1st of April"
    '[NatNum12 D=ordinal]D" of "MMMM'         -> "first of April"
    '[NatNum12 YYYY=year,D=ordinal]D" of "MMMM", "YYYY' ->
    "first of April, nineteen ninety"
    
    Note: set only for YYYY, MMMM, M, DDDD, D and NNN/AAAA
    in date formats. It's possible to extend this for other
    keywords and date + time combinations, as required.
    
    Note 2: default l10n date formats can use the new NatNum12 date
    formats, see FormatElement in i18npool/source/localedata/
    XML files and FormatElement specification:
    https://opengrok.libreoffice.org/xref/core/i18npool/source/localedata/data/locale.dtd#223
    
    Change-Id: I598849f1492f4012e83cef9293773badbff16206
    Reviewed-on: https://gerrit.libreoffice.org/55613Tested-by: 's avatarJenkins <ci@libreoffice.org>
    Reviewed-by: 's avatarLászló Németh <nemeth@numbertext.org>
    958c2324
Adı
Son kayıt (commit)
Son güncelleme
..
inc Loading commit data...
qa/cppunit Loading commit data...
source Loading commit data...
util Loading commit data...
CppunitTest_i18npool_test_breakiterator.mk Loading commit data...
CppunitTest_i18npool_test_characterclassification.mk Loading commit data...
CppunitTest_i18npool_test_ordinalsuffix.mk Loading commit data...
CppunitTest_i18npool_test_textsearch.mk Loading commit data...
CustomTarget_breakiterator.mk Loading commit data...
CustomTarget_collator.mk Loading commit data...
CustomTarget_indexentry.mk Loading commit data...
CustomTarget_localedata.mk Loading commit data...
CustomTarget_textconversion.mk Loading commit data...
Executable_gencoll_rule.mk Loading commit data...
Executable_genconv_dict.mk Loading commit data...
Executable_gendict.mk Loading commit data...
Executable_genindex_data.mk Loading commit data...
Executable_saxparser.mk Loading commit data...
Library_collator_data.mk Loading commit data...
Library_dict_ja.mk Loading commit data...
Library_dict_zh.mk Loading commit data...
Library_i18npool.mk Loading commit data...
Library_i18nsearch.mk Loading commit data...
Library_index_data.mk Loading commit data...
Library_localedata_en.mk Loading commit data...
Library_localedata_es.mk Loading commit data...
Library_localedata_euro.mk Loading commit data...
Library_localedata_others.mk Loading commit data...
Library_textconv_dict.mk Loading commit data...
Makefile Loading commit data...
Module_i18npool.mk Loading commit data...
README Loading commit data...
Rdb_saxparser.mk Loading commit data...